Latest Patents:
Hayahi's latest patents showcase his ingenuity and creativity. The "Foldable device and method for disposing flexible cable" patent introduces a unique hinge design that optimizes space and functionality in foldable devices. Additionally, the "Fitting structure for conductive sheet and electronic device" patent revolutionizes how conductive sheets are integrated into electronic devices, enhancing connectivity and efficiency.
